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# .NET
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.50/2: Рейтинг темы: голосов - 2, средняя оценка - 4.50
Igarek
1 / 1 / 0
Регистрация: 28.05.2010
Сообщений: 16
1

сохранять или нет

04.06.2010, 17:38. Просмотров 446. Ответов 1
Метки нет (Все метки)

как сделать так чтобы при выходе чтобы спрашивало при нажатии клавиши button5 (сохранять изменения да или нет) если да выполнится:
C++
1
2
3
4
this.оБЩАЯ_ТАБЛИЦАTableAdapter.Update(this.база_даных_по_курсовойDataSet.ОБЩАЯ_ТАБЛИЦА);
this.болезньTableAdapter.Update(this.база_даных_по_курсовойDataSet.Болезнь);
this.врачиTableAdapter.Update(this.база_даных_по_курсовойDataSet.Врачи);
this.пациентыTableAdapter.Update(this.база_даных_по_курсовойDataSet.Пациенты);
C#
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
 
namespace Windows
{
    public partial class Form1 : Form
    {
        public Form1()
        {
            InitializeComponent();
        }
 
        private void Form1_Load(object sender, EventArgs e)
        {
            // TODO: данная строка кода позволяет загрузить данные в таблицу "база_даных_по_курсовойDataSet.Пациенты". При необходимости она может быть перемещена или удалена.
            this.пациентыTableAdapter.Fill(this.база_даных_по_курсовойDataSet.Пациенты);
            // TODO: данная строка кода позволяет загрузить данные в таблицу "база_даных_по_курсовойDataSet.Врачи". При необходимости она может быть перемещена или удалена.
            this.врачиTableAdapter.Fill(this.база_даных_по_курсовойDataSet.Врачи);
            // TODO: данная строка кода позволяет загрузить данные в таблицу "база_даных_по_курсовойDataSet.Болезнь". При необходимости она может быть перемещена или удалена.
            this.болезньTableAdapter.Fill(this.база_даных_по_курсовойDataSet.Болезнь);
            // TODO: данная строка кода позволяет загрузить данные в таблицу "база_даных_по_курсовойDataSet.ОБЩАЯ_ТАБЛИЦА". При необходимости она может быть перемещена или удалена.
            this.оБЩАЯ_ТАБЛИЦАTableAdapter.Fill(this.база_даных_по_курсовойDataSet.ОБЩАЯ_ТАБЛИЦА);
 
        }
 
        private void dataGridView1_CellContentClick(object sender, DataGridViewCellEventArgs e)
        {
 
        }
 
        private void Сохранить_Click(object sender, EventArgs e)
        {
            this.оБЩАЯ_ТАБЛИЦАTableAdapter.Update(this.база_даных_по_курсовойDataSet.ОБЩАЯ_ТАБЛИЦА);
        }
 
        private void dataGridView2_CellContentClick(object sender, DataGridViewCellEventArgs e)
        {
 
        }
 
        private void button1_Click(object sender, EventArgs e)
        {
            this.болезньTableAdapter.Update(this.база_даных_по_курсовойDataSet.Болезнь);
        }
 
        private void button2_Click(object sender, EventArgs e)
        {
            this.врачиTableAdapter.Update(this.база_даных_по_курсовойDataSet.Врачи);
        }
 
        private void button3_Click(object sender, EventArgs e)
        {
            this.пациентыTableAdapter.Update(this.база_даных_по_курсовойDataSet.Пациенты);
        }
 
        private void button4_Click(object sender, EventArgs e)
        {
            Form2 about = new Form2();
            about.ShowDialog();
        }
 
        private void dataGridView3_CellContentClick(object sender, DataGridViewCellEventArgs e)
        {
 
        }
 
        private void button5_Click(object sender, EventArgs e)
        {
 
 
        }
 
        private void richTextBox1_TextChanged(object sender, EventArgs e)
        {
 
        }
 
      
    }
}
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
04.06.2010, 17:38
Ответы с готовыми решениями:

Баг или нет
Функции char.IsDigit(); char.IsNumber(); работают идентично в VS2012 и не реагируют на...

Узнать онлайн ли компьютер или нет
Всем привет. У меня есть одна задача. Нужно знать онлайн ли компьютер, у которого запущен мой софт...

Проверка, дошла почта или нет
Можно ли проверить дошла ли почта до клиента или нет. Хотя бы проверить прошло ли письмо через...

Проверка на загруженный файл или нет
if (!File.Exists(richTextBox1.Text)) { ...

Проверить, распечатался документ или нет
Возникла следующая проблема: хочу обработать отпечатался ли документ или нет. Почитал, вроде нужно...

1
IICuX
84 / 84 / 26
Регистрация: 04.01.2010
Сообщений: 270
04.06.2010, 20:41 2
у формы обработайте событие FormClozing

и напишите:

C#
1
2
3
4
if (MessageBox.Show("Ваш вопрос!", "Сохранение", MessageBoxButtons.YesNo, MessageBoxIcon.Question) == DialogResult.Yes)
{
//Сохраняете что нужно
}
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
04.06.2010, 20:41

Статическое событие. Костыль или нет
Суть следующая. Приложение на андроид. В нем динамически создаются диалоговые окна (класс...

Создание отчета. CrystalReport или нет??
Добрый день. Ребята помогите плиз. Пишу приложение на шарпе, которое считает данные из нескольких...

Как проверить, существует ли директория или нет
Доброе время суток. Вот столкнулся с такой задачкой, нужно проверить существует ли директория,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, vBulletin Solutions, Inc.
Рейтинг@Mail.ru